NEAR Protocol’s AI and Intents Drive Significant Market Revival

NEAR Protocol's recent advancements in multichain interoperability and AI infrastructure have led to a nearly 50% increase in its token value over the past 90 days, signifying renewed investor interest.

The NEAR Protocol has seen a notable resurgence recently, with its native token appreciating by nearly 50% over a 90-day period. What factors are driving this renewed investor enthusiasm? Central to this momentum are NEAR's ambitious developments in multichain interoperability through NEAR Intents and a forward-thinking commitment to artificial intelligence via NEAR AI.

NEAR's ongoing technical innovations are key to its success. Features like Nightshade sharding, native account abstraction, and chain signatures enable smooth multichain interactions. These advancements allow users to trade assets across incompatible networks without manual bridging, significantly simplifying the process. The NEAR Intents framework exemplifies this by enabling users to execute transactions across chains like Ethereum and Bitcoin with remarkable ease, thanks to mechanisms like chain signatures and a network of solvers.

The data highlights the effectiveness of NEAR Intents. Since its launch, the protocol has processed over $18 billion in crosschain volume, with $5 billion occurring just in the first quarter of 2026. This increase in transaction activity underscores the growing adoption of the Intents framework, as more applications integrate this functionality. Projects like Zashi, Infinex, and Kyber have already adopted NEAR Intents, leading to a cohesive ecosystem that supports diverse trading options without the friction of centralized exchanges.

The Role of NEAR AI

While NEAR Intents capture immediate attention, the NEAR AI initiative is equally significant. As demand for AI agents in the marketplace rises, a reliable infrastructure becomes essential. NEAR AI aims to serve as a foundational layer for this emerging agentic economy, providing secure environments for AI-driven transactions and operations. This includes features like Cloud for private inference, Agent Hosting for virtual agents, and a Confidential GPU Marketplace for enterprise AI workloads.

Although NEAR AI has yet to reach the transaction volumes seen with NEAR Intents, its potential enhances the overall ecosystem. AI agents conducting transactions across multiple chains via Intents, paired with the secure operational space provided by NEAR AI, positions the protocol uniquely in the evolving field of AI commerce. As AI agents become more integral to financial operations, the infrastructure supporting them will likely gain increasing importance.

Tokenomics and Market Implications

In addition to technical advancements, NEAR’s revamped tokenomics model is designed to channel revenues generated from these initiatives back into $NEAR buybacks. This creates a positive feedback loop that supports the token's value and boosts investor confidence. Current market sentiment seems to reflect the potential longevity and impact of NEAR’s developments, with many viewing the protocol's innovations as indicators of real staying power.

As the cryptocurrency market continues to evolve, NEAR Protocol’s strategic focus on multichain interoperability and AI infrastructure could position it as a key player. By addressing the needs of both users and developers, NEAR is establishing itself as a vital platform within the AI-driven economy. With ongoing advancements in both NEAR Intents and NEAR AI, the future looks promising for this ambitious protocol, suggesting its influence may only grow in the coming years.
